Gulf Stream jumps as an AMOC-collapse warning

Open paper intelligence

In a 0.1° ocean hosing run, the Gulf Stream leaps north near 71.5°W years before AMOC collapses, a pattern also hinted at in altimetry.

What they did

Authors analyzed a high-resolution CESM-POP freshwater-hosing simulation, tracked the Gulf Stream with dynamic sea level and the 15°C north wall, and compared transports with RAPID, the Florida Current, GLORYS12, and AVISO.

What they found

Initial AMOC is 19.9 Sv versus 17 Sv observed. After slow Deep Western Boundary Current weakening, the Stream jumps ~2° north at 71.5°W in model years 392–394, before AMOC collapses near year 420 to a 5.1 Sv remnant. Local SST jumps ~4°C in two years.

The limits

What it doesn't show

This is a stand-alone ocean hosing experiment, not a coupled CO2 scenario; Florida Current is 14% weak and DWBC 36% strong versus reanalysis, so lead times may differ in nature.

Key terms

AMOC
Atlantic Meridional Overturning Circulation, a northward upper and southward deep Atlantic flow.
Gulf Stream north wall
15°C isotherm at 200 m used to locate the Stream’s northern edge.
Hosing
Imposed freshwater forcing that can collapse the AMOC.
Deep Western Boundary Current
Deep southward AMOC limb along the American slope.
RAPID-MOCHA
Observing array at 26.5°N monitoring AMOC and the Florida Current.

Common questions

Ocean resolution?

0.1° POP, fine enough for a realistic Cape Hatteras separation.

When does the Stream jump?

Model years 392–394, before AMOC collapse near year 420.

Collapsed AMOC strength?

About 5.1 Sv.

Observational check?

AVISO altimetry 1993–2025 shows a northward shift near separation.
